Logarithm
Hawkins' Electrical Dictionary · 1915 · p. 3
—In higher mathematics, one of a cla of artificial numbers, devised by Napier (A. D. 1600), to abridge arithmetical calculations, and by the use of carefully prepared “Tables of Logarithms, ” to shorten the difficult operations of raising to powers and the extraction of roots.
